From the moment Jennifer Aniston graced our screens with ‘The Rachel’ on Friends, she’s been setting hair trends. There are her go-to beachy waves, short and choppy bobs, and the rare slicked-back pony. In honor of her latest Emmy nomination for The Morning Show, let’s relive the complete evolution of Aniston’s enviable locks.

1995
“I think it was the ugliest haircut I’ve ever seen,” Aniston told Allure in 2011 of Rachel Green’s polarizing hairstyle.
5 of 56
January 1, 1995
“It was a really fun cut and different to anything else around at the time. It was an easy cut, but it needed regular trims to keep the layers looking sharp,” says hair stylist Chris McMillan of his famous “Rachel” cut.
